generate jaxb classes from wsdl
values in one of the generated Java objects and then marshal the object into an XML Schema document that appears in the You can use the set methods defined for a class to modify the content of elements and attributes.

You can find the JAXB 1.0 specification at the following URL: The Oracle Database XDK implementation of the JAXB 1.0 specification does not support the following optional features: XML Schema concepts described in section E.2 of the specification. The command that control this process uses data that you specify in the Generate Java Code from Wsdl or Wadl dialog.

We will check its existence by checking if the content contains schemaLocation or not using the IndexOf command. Use the Generate Java Code from Wsdl or Wadl dialog to generate the client … This is done using JAXB … The goal of this exercise is to familiarize ourselves with the tools files and code that the IDE has generated for you. You must only type the When you access an XML The generated/ subdirectory contains the classes generated from the input schema. nbj2ee Run As -> Maven generate-sources wasn't working for me. For example, if the schema defines an element named , then by default the JAXB class generator generates a source file named AnElement.java and another named AnElementImpl.java. Specify whether to generate classes for schema arrays or use Java arrays. http://java.sun.com/xml/jaxb/faq.html for more information on JAXB, Oracle Database XML Java API Reference for details of the JAXB API, "Processing XML with the JAXB Class Generator" for detailed explanations of JAXB processing. document.write(user + at + domain); The program unmarshals the document twice: it first returns an Object and then uses a cast to return a MyBusiness object. You can use the declaration to customize the name for an interface or the class that implements an interface. For example, the interface includes getTitle() for retrieving data in the element and setTitle() for modifying data in this element. Opinions expressed by DZone contributors are their own. You can perform this task by either unmarshalling the data from an XML document that conforms to the schema or instantiating the classes. That’s why we have written one task called jaxb to generate the jaxb classes from xsd files. <br> <br>The following statement illustrates this technique: Instantiate the unmarshaller. getEventHandler() returns the current or default event handler. Generating JAXB artifacts from XSD/WSDL through Maven. To decrease the size of the final JAR, let's get rid of the Java files. <br> <br>Over a million developers have joined DZone. You can also validate on demand by calling the validation API on the Java object. The customization of a Java package name. My Learning’s on JAVA/J2EE, Oracle Fusion Middleware, Spring, Weblogic Server, Adobe Experience Manager(AEM) and WebTechnologies, generate[ERROR] No goals have been specified for this build. Right-click the WSDL file and choose Open. Each element in the sequence describes one part of the address: name, door number, and so forth. Specify the default type mapping registry for mapping an XML qualified name to a Java class, using a specified Deserializer. The Address complex type defined a sequence of elements: name, doorNumber, street, and city. The make utility performs the following sequential actions for each sample subdirectory: Runs the orajaxb utility to generate Java class files based on an input XML schema. The following code fragment illustrates this technique: Create a marshaller. tooling support for JAXB. <p>.</p> <a href='https://www.jaszfenyszaru.hu/blog/eddie-money-wife-14fc3c'>Eddie Money Wife</a>, <a href='https://www.jaszfenyszaru.hu/blog/ac-odyssey-i-never-found-nikolaos-or-i-killed-nikolaos-14fc3c'>Ac Odyssey I Never Found Nikolaos Or I Killed Nikolaos</a>, <a href='https://www.jaszfenyszaru.hu/blog/planet-minecraft-medieval-castle-14fc3c'>Planet Minecraft Medieval Castle</a>, <a href='https://www.jaszfenyszaru.hu/blog/christopher-rice-broadway-age-14fc3c'>Christopher Rice Broadway Age</a>, <a href='https://www.jaszfenyszaru.hu/blog/viking-banner-minecraft-14fc3c'>Viking Banner Minecraft</a>, <a href='https://www.jaszfenyszaru.hu/blog/josh-campbell-wife-14fc3c'>Josh Campbell Wife</a>, <a href='https://www.jaszfenyszaru.hu/blog/lexi-randall-houston-tx-14fc3c'>Lexi Randall Houston Tx</a>, <a href='https://www.jaszfenyszaru.hu/blog/throne-bikes-review-14fc3c'>Throne Bikes Review</a>, <a href='https://www.jaszfenyszaru.hu/blog/huddy-6-birthday-14fc3c'>Huddy 6 Birthday</a>, <a href='https://www.jaszfenyszaru.hu/blog/how-old-is-alicia-knievel-14fc3c'>How Old Is Alicia Knievel</a>, <a href='https://www.jaszfenyszaru.hu/blog/mockingbird-stroller-car-seat-14fc3c'>Mockingbird Stroller Car Seat</a>, <a href='https://www.jaszfenyszaru.hu/blog/hikaru-nara-meaning-14fc3c'>Hikaru Nara Meaning</a>, <a href='https://www.jaszfenyszaru.hu/blog/alexa-kpop-wiki-14fc3c'>Alexa Kpop Wiki</a>, <a href='https://www.jaszfenyszaru.hu/blog/borderlands-3-red-chest-14fc3c'>Borderlands 3 Red Chest</a>, <a href='https://www.jaszfenyszaru.hu/blog/carnival-puns-for-captions-14fc3c'>Carnival Puns For Captions</a>, <a href='https://www.jaszfenyszaru.hu/blog/sydney-shapiro-khosrowshahi-age-14fc3c'>Sydney Shapiro Khosrowshahi Age</a>, <a href='https://www.jaszfenyszaru.hu/blog/cowboy-name-generator-14fc3c'>Cowboy Name Generator</a>, <a href='https://www.jaszfenyszaru.hu/blog/can-they-touch-you-at-scream-a-geddon-14fc3c'>Can They Touch You At Scream A Geddon</a>, <a href='https://www.jaszfenyszaru.hu/blog/claude-joseph-bird-height-14fc3c'>Claude Joseph Bird Height</a>, <a href='https://www.jaszfenyszaru.hu/blog/rudy-bourgarel-ethnicity-14fc3c'>Rudy Bourgarel Ethnicity</a>, <a href='https://www.jaszfenyszaru.hu/blog/business-model-canvas-google-slide-14fc3c'>Business Model Canvas Google Slide</a>, <a href='https://www.jaszfenyszaru.hu/blog/roborock-s5-reset-map-14fc3c'>Roborock S5 Reset Map</a>, <a href='https://www.jaszfenyszaru.hu/blog/atari-vault-roms-14fc3c'>Atari Vault Roms</a>, <a href='https://www.jaszfenyszaru.hu/blog/galway-bay-fm-news-death-notices-14fc3c'>Galway Bay Fm News Death Notices</a>, <a href='https://www.jaszfenyszaru.hu/blog/cessna-210-speed-mods-14fc3c'>Cessna 210 Speed Mods</a>, <a href='https://www.jaszfenyszaru.hu/blog/silver-river-boat-ramp-14fc3c'>Silver River Boat Ramp</a>, <a href='https://www.jaszfenyszaru.hu/blog/spongebob-ice-cream-bar-figure-14fc3c'>Spongebob Ice Cream Bar Figure</a>, <a href='https://www.jaszfenyszaru.hu/blog/malaysia-flight-370-bodies-found-in-cambodia-14fc3c'>Malaysia Flight 370 Bodies Found In Cambodia</a>, <a href='https://www.jaszfenyszaru.hu/blog/nidhogg-vs-jormungand-14fc3c'>Nidhogg Vs Jormungand</a>, <a href='https://www.jaszfenyszaru.hu/blog/wild-hawaii-fiery-paradise-narrator-14fc3c'>Wild Hawaii Fiery Paradise Narrator</a>, <a href='https://www.jaszfenyszaru.hu/blog/deca-sports-teams-14fc3c'>Deca Sports Teams</a>, <a href='https://www.jaszfenyszaru.hu/blog/kymtha-namaskaram-pdf-14fc3c'>Kymtha Namaskaram Pdf</a>, <a href='https://www.jaszfenyszaru.hu/blog/asda-sharesave-2020-login-14fc3c'>Asda Sharesave 2020 Login</a>, <a href='https://www.jaszfenyszaru.hu/blog/flashlights-on-beach-at-night-14fc3c'>Flashlights On Beach At Night</a>, <a href='https://www.jaszfenyszaru.hu/blog/claudia-animal-crossing-popularity-14fc3c'>Claudia Animal Crossing Popularity</a>, <a href='https://www.jaszfenyszaru.hu/blog/lottery-pick-3-14fc3c'>Lottery Pick 3</a>, <a href='https://www.jaszfenyszaru.hu/blog/finding-chika-book-club-questions-14fc3c'>Finding Chika Book Club Questions</a>, <span class="et_pb_scroll_top et-pb-icon"></span> <footer id="main-footer"> <div id="et-footer-nav"> <div class="container"> <ul class="bottom-nav" id="menu-main-menu"><li class="menu-item menu-item-type-post_type menu-item-object-page menu-item-home menu-item-52"><a href="#">Home</a></li> <li class="menu-item menu-item-type-post_type menu-item-object-page menu-item-50"><a href="#">About</a></li> <li class="menu-item menu-item-type-custom menu-item-object-custom menu-item-54"><a href="#">Contact</a></li> <li class="menu-item menu-item-type-post_type menu-item-object-page current_page_parent menu-item-51"><a href="#">Blog</a></li> </ul> </div> </div> <div id="footer-bottom"> <div class="container clearfix"> <div id="footer-info">generate jaxb classes from wsdl 2020</div></div> </div> </footer> </div> </div> </body> </html>